Output ec3ce742a2d9bbd584734b8422b511a31a7e1363237b0222f2dcad843fa35066:15

value
50009690
script pubkey
OP_0 OP_PUSHBYTES_20 c2a5151a09db31bed238785f08b5617679b33b65
address
bc1qc2j32xsfmvcma53c0p0s3dtpweumxwm980urtv
transaction
ec3ce742a2d9bbd584734b8422b511a31a7e1363237b0222f2dcad843fa35066
spent
true